Concrete lifting services involve raising and leveling sunken or uneven concrete slabs to restore their original position and stability. This process typically uses specialized techniques such as polyurethane foam injection or mudjacking to lift the affected areas without the need for complete removal and replacement. The goal is to improve safety, functionality, and appearance by addressing issues caused by ground settling, erosion, or poor initial installation. These services are often chosen for their minimally invasive nature and quick turnaround compared to traditional concrete replacement methods.

One of the primary problems concrete lifting services help resolve is uneven or cracked slabs that can create tripping hazards or hinder the use of outdoor spaces. Sunken dri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ors are common areas where these issues occur. When concrete shifts or sinks, it can lead to water pooling, further deterioration, and potential damage to underlying structures. By lifting and leveling the concrete, service providers help prevent further deterioration, reduce safety risks, and improve the overall appearance of the property.

Cost Range for Concrete Lifting - Typical costs for concrete lifting services can vary between $500 and $2,500 depending on the size and extent of the project. Smaller slabs, such as walkways or patios, tend to be on the lower end of the spectrum. Larger driveways or multiple slabs may approach the higher end.

Factors Influencing Pricing - The overall cost may be affected by factors like the depth of the lift, access to the site, and the type of foam or materials used. Additional prep work or repairs can also increase the total expense. Contact local pros for tailored estimates.

Average Cost per Square Foot - On average, concrete lifting services may range from $3 to $8 per square foot. For example, lifting a 100-square-foot slab might cost between $300 and $800. Larger or more complex projects can cost more per square foot.

Additional Cost Considerations - Extra charges may apply for removal of old concrete, site preparation, or repairs needed before lifting. What is concrete lifting? Concrete lifting involves raising and leveling sunken or uneven concrete surfaces using specialized techniques and materials to restore their original position.

How do professionals perform concrete lifting? Local service providers typically use methods like polyurethane foam injection or mudjacking to lift and stabilize affected concrete slabs.

Is concrete lifting suitable for all types of concrete surfaces? Concrete lifting is effective for dri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ors that have settled or become uneven.

How long does concrete lifting typically take? The process usually takes a few hours, depending on the size and number of slabs being lifted.
